A letter from WEP concerning a meeting of magistrates,
Part of Nanteos estate records
A letter from WEP to John [ ] concerning the calling of a meeting of magistrates in Aberaeron at a convenient time for Colonel Love: the matter of the destruction of Llan-non Toll House, Isaac Evans accused. If there were sufficient proof then Sir James Grahame should be informed as it was desirable to keep troops in different parts of the county.
